Transaction cc74878c3148df7f0bedbb0a7af450952c30c1fd819df4590415648f48c273ea
1 Input
1 Output
-
cc74878c3148df7f0bedbb0a7af450952c30c1fd819df4590415648f48c273ea:0
- value
- 1986762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5afec8e55e73c623b0edc298cce53ccbd216155 OP_EQUAL
- address
- 3Q66DxbFWcv2TfdnXnM6cyacxXtYo2FqqF